About Bari Village

Bari is a small village in Nadaun tehsil, in the district of Hamirpur, Himachal Pradesh.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 42, made up of 15 males and 27 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 1,800 females per 1000 males. The village covers 18.93 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 177048,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.

Getting to Bari

The census records public bus service for Bari as Available within village. Private bus service is recorded as Available within village. For rail, the census notes the nearest railway station as Available within 10+ km distance. These entries describe what was recorded in 2011 and services may have changed since.
